### Runbook: BounceBroom — Account Recovery

If the BounceBroom email bounce processor loses access to its service account, do not create a new one. First, pause the intake queue so bounces buffer safely. Then open the recovery console and select the BounceBroom principal. Verification requires approval from the on-call lead. Once approved, the console prompts for the stored recovery credentials; enter the passphrase that appears directly below this paragraph.

recovery phrase for fahof-kahap: holion-gormir-jorix-istix-briwyn-sorael

/*
 * Per-tenant rate quotas for the Marrowgate API tier.
 * Quotas are enforced at the edge with a token bucket per tenant;
 * burst capacity is intentionally generous so short spikes from the
 * Pellhaven importer don't trip alerts. Changing refill rates requires
 * a matching update to the billing reconciler, or overage reports
 * drift. Do not special-case individual tenants here — use the
 * override table instead. The baseline constants follow.
 */

constants for bagag-fawip:
BUDGETS = {
    "wenius": 400,
    "brieth": 224,
    "rusath": 783,
    "eliys": 187,
    "aldax": 737,
    "ralion": 818,
    "istius": 153,
}

Minutes — Bramleigh Retail Management Meeting

Topic: next year's headcount. Short version: modest growth. Two new hires per branch in Kellbrook and Norvale, a freeze elsewhere until Q2 numbers land. Tomas will share role templates next week. Branch managers, hold off on postings until sign-off. The confidential reasoning sits just below.

internal memo for fajog-yagaf: Gross margin on Ulaael came in at 20 percent against a plan of 10 percent. Only 9 of the 80 pilot accounts renewed Ulaael, so a churn review is set for July 1.